From 97dc9df075303cb024cfd6280a3a4e6efa2f1426 Mon Sep 17 00:00:00 2001 From: Joshua Granick Date: Wed, 16 Apr 2014 15:39:46 -0700 Subject: [PATCH] Cleanup, compile fix --- .../src/org/haxe/lime/GameActivity.java | 98 +++++++++---------- 1 file changed, 47 insertions(+), 51 deletions(-) diff --git a/templates/android/template/src/org/haxe/lime/GameActivity.java b/templates/android/template/src/org/haxe/lime/GameActivity.java index 4a484bc31..2f83b9560 100644 --- a/templates/android/template/src/org/haxe/lime/GameActivity.java +++ b/templates/android/template/src/org/haxe/lime/GameActivity.java @@ -98,21 +98,16 @@ public class GameActivity extends Activity implements SensorEventListener { requestWindowFeature (Window.FEATURE_NO_TITLE); - ::if WIN_FULLSCREEN:: - ::if (ANDROID_TARGET_SDK_VERSION < 19):: - getWindow().addFlags(WindowManager.LayoutParams.FLAG_FULLSCREEN - | WindowManager.LayoutParams.FLAG_KEEP_SCREEN_ON); - ::end:: - ::end:: - + ::if (ANDROID_TARGET_SDK_VERSION < 19):: + getWindow().addFlags(WindowManager.LayoutParams.FLAG_FULLSCREEN + | WindowManager.LayoutParams.FLAG_KEEP_SCREEN_ON); + ::end:: + ::end:: metrics = new DisplayMetrics (); getWindowManager ().getDefaultDisplay ().getMetrics (metrics); - - Log.d ("lime", "mMainView is NULL"); - ::foreach ndlls:: System.loadLibrary ("::name::"); ::end:: @@ -120,7 +115,7 @@ public class GameActivity extends Activity implements SensorEventListener { mView = new MainView (getApplication (), this); setContentView (mView); - + Extension.mainView = mView; sensorManager = (SensorManager)activity.getSystemService (Context.SENSOR_SERVICE); @@ -132,11 +127,11 @@ public class GameActivity extends Activity implements SensorEventListener { } - Extension.PACKAGE_NAME = getApplicationContext().getPackageName(); + Extension.packageName = getApplicationContext ().getPackageName (); if (extensions == null) { - extensions = new ArrayList(); + extensions = new ArrayList (); ::if (ANDROID_EXTENSIONS != null)::::foreach ANDROID_EXTENSIONS:: extensions.add (new ::__current__:: ());::end::::end:: @@ -402,19 +397,6 @@ public class GameActivity extends Activity implements SensorEventListener { } - @Override - protected void onNewIntent(final Intent intent) { - for (Extension extension : extensions) { - extension.onNewIntent (intent); - } - super.onNewIntent (intent); - } - - @Override - public void onBackPressed() { - - } - @Override protected void onActivityResult (int requestCode, int resultCode, Intent data) { @@ -449,6 +431,32 @@ public class GameActivity extends Activity implements SensorEventListener { } + @Override public void onLowMemory () { + + super.onLowMemory (); + + for (Extension extension : extensions) { + + extension.onLowMemory (); + + } + + } + + + @Override protected void onNewIntent (final Intent intent) { + + for (Extension extension : extensions) { + + extension.onNewIntent (intent); + + } + + super.onNewIntent (intent); + + } + + @Override protected void onPause () { doPause (); @@ -489,31 +497,6 @@ public class GameActivity extends Activity implements SensorEventListener { } - - @Override public void onLowMemory () { - - super.onLowMemory (); - - for (Extension extension : extensions) { - - extension.onLowMemory (); - - } - } - - - @Override public void onTrimMemory (int level) { - - super.onTrimMemory (level); - - for (Extension extension : extensions) { - - extension.onTrimMemory (level); - - } - - } - @Override public void onSensorChanged (SensorEvent event) { @@ -571,6 +554,19 @@ public class GameActivity extends Activity implements SensorEventListener { } + @Override public void onTrimMemory (int level) { + + super.onTrimMemory (level); + + for (Extension extension : extensions) { + + extension.onTrimMemory (level); + + } + + } + + public static void popView () { activity.setContentView (activity.mView);